After Effects 25.3/4 freezing and crashing

  • August 18, 2025
  • 6 replies
  • 351 views

Hello, I'm having a sudden issue arise within After Effects today, whenever I am scrubbing through the timeline or hitting play to preview. The viewport freezes completely on a static frame even though all UI and functions seem to continue to work as normal and can be selected, shortly after this I will get a not responding notice at the top of the window which continues indefinitely until I force close.

 

I have tried updating to the latest version of AE, rolling back as well updating/rolling back my drivers. Strangely nothing has changed on my device between the last session working in AE (the day before) yet these issues have suddenly appeared in any project file newly created or already exisiting.

 

I have also tried changes in preferences and project settings (multi frame rendering, CUDA to mercury, etc) but I'm having no luck. Lastly I've tried a fresh install of After effects but no change to the problem, unsure of what else to try or the sudden cause for this repeating problem. Any help here would be greatly appreciated!

 

Thank you

 

NVIDIA Geforce RTX 5080 16GB

Intel Ultra 9 275HX

32GB Ram

Windows 11

1TB SSD

I've been having the same issues also on a brand new laptop - basically your spec, just a bit more RAM.

 

I went through everything, all the basic fixes that you advised to do; update AE and all drivers, removed plugins, fresh install, settings inside AE, turning off setting in the NVidia app for games, trying the Nnvidia creation driver over the game driver...literally I can't really remember everything I've done there's been so much and yet it was still happening, in a single comp with 3 PNGs and a bit of audio. Frozen viewport but the rest of the UI worked fine, even saving the file.

 

In the end I installed the oldest version 24 and there's been no issue (hopefully I've not jixed it).

 

I've used Adobe products for years and I should know by now...don't use the most up to date version.
